Loadrunner构建性能测试中心
提高组织效率
许多公司除了选择标准负载测试解决方案以外,逐渐转向一种 IT 共享服务模式(称为性能测试 CoE),用来提高生产效率、实现流程标准化。通过 HP Performance Center 创建的
CoE 所获得的效率包括:测试生产效率提高、应用程序团队之间的协作增强、以及外包某些或全部负载测试的性工作的能力改进。CoE 有助于共享实践和技能,并且可以通过在企业范围内快速的测试交付能力来提高您的企业效率。简而言之,CoE 模式可以提高基础设施和人力资源的应用,并终使企业整体质量提高。
支持整个企业的协作
性能测试人员通过 Web可以全天候进行所有测试操作,包括:上传测试脚本、安排负载测试、创建负载测试场景、运行多项负载测试、监控测试执行情况以及分析结果。执行测试时,任意数量的用户均可以远程观察测试,并且可以对被测应用配置自定义视图。 HP Performance Center 可以提供协作式基础设施,以便让项目经理、开发人员和性能工程师都可以实时查看负载测试数据、进度和运行信息。 HP Performance Center 可以通过诸如基于
Web访问、资产共享、项目分组和版本控制之类功能来提高团队内的协作。
衡量应用行为的更好方法
为了消除生产和测试之间的差异,HP Performance Center能够利用实际的生产环境性能数据以便在测试时更好地重现应用行为。
HP
真实用户监控(Real
User Monitor,RUM)能够转化为性能测试脚本。与生产环境使用情况相关的数据能够从HP 业务服务管理(Business Service Management)或第三方解决方案(如WebTrends)直接导入到HP
Performance Center。HP
Performance Center使测试团队能够了解应用在生产环境中是如何被使用的,以及应用的实际表现。这有助于更好地创建能够反映真实情况的测试场景。根据了解的结果,他们能够规划和执行和现实的性能测试。
类似地,SiteScope监控指标和配置能够被导入,加速测试环境的设置。





Loadrunner可以通过录制直接生成脚本,极大地节省了开发和调试脚本的工作量。VU可以先记录下业务流程,然后将其转化为测试脚本。建立测试脚本后,可以对其进行参数化操作,这样可以利用几套不同的实际发生数据来测试应用程序。以一个订单输入过程为例,性能测试工具loadrunnerloadrunner教程,参数化操作可将记录中的固定数据,如订和客户名称,由可变量来代替。在这些变量内随意输入可能的订和客户吗,loadrunner教程,来匹配多个实际用户的操作行为。
Controller创建性能测试方案
虚拟用户脚本生成后,使用Loadrunner的Controller可以根据需要设定负载方案、业务流程组合和虚拟用户数,创建不同的性能场景。
Controller能够创建基于目标和手工的性能测试场景。前者可使用户关注某项他感兴趣的性能指标,后者则可
考察整个软件系统在既定负载下的性能表现。
性能测试策略Loadrunner性能测试场景压力测试面向目标测试场景+忽略think time负载测试手工测试场景+同步点+虚拟IP+宽带模拟基准测试脚本和场景复用并发测试同步点+多虚拟用户
数据驱动
Loadrunner将业务流程和业务数据分离,并且很。其中有一个很有用的功能,就是Data Wizard。通过Data Wizard来自动实现测试数据的参数化。Data Wizard与数据库服务器直接连接,从中可以获取所需的数据(如订和用户名),并将其直接输入到测试脚本。这样避免了人工处理数据的需要。
服务器检测
Loadrunner可以检查出性能延迟的地方:网络或客户端延迟、CPU性能、I/O延迟、数据库锁定和数据库服务器上的其他问题。这是因为Loadrunner内含集成的实时监测器。在负载测试过程的任何时候,都可以观察到应用系统的运行性能,包括服务器、数据库、网络设备等。
测试结果分析
一旦测试完毕后,Loadrunner收集汇总所有的测试数据。它还提供的分析和报告工具,以便迅速查找到性能问题并追溯原由。 使用Loadrunner的事务细节监测器可以了解到所有的图片、框架和文本到每一个网页上所需的时间。例如,能够分析是否因为一个大尺寸的图形文件或第三方的数据组件早场应用系统运行速度减慢。另外,软件性能测试工具loadrunner教程,Web事务细节监测器分解客户端、网络和服务器上端到端所用的反应时间,便于确认问题,定位查找真正出错的组件。例如可以将网络延迟进行分析,判断解析DNS,连接服务器或SSL认证所花费的时间。通过使用Loadrunner的分析工具,能很快查找到出错的位置和原因,游戏性能测试工具loadrunner教程,并做出相应的调整。
Loadrunner 12.53的问题(Oracle数据库连接)
你好
我做了一些挖掘,这里是实际的条目,使我们的案例工作:
[ORACLE_WINNT]
1102= lrdo32.dll+ oraclient11.dll
所以也许你需要匹配服务器返回的确切的版本。
而且还需要在Vugen机器和LG上安装Oracle客户端。 对于以前的版本,只需找到Oracle客户端dll并将其放在/ bin文件夹中即可,但对于1版,我们只能使其完全安装oracle客户端。
br / ola
如果您的问题或问题得到解决,请将帖子标记为已解决。
如果这篇文章对你有价值,请考虑一下。
苏州华克斯-软件性能测试工具loadrunner教程由苏州华克斯信息科技有限公司提供。苏州华克斯信息科技有限公司位于苏州工业园区新平街388号。在市场经济的浪潮中拼博和发展,目前华克斯在行业软件中享有良好的声誉。华克斯取得全网商盟认证,标志着我们的服务和管理水平达到了一个新的高度。华克斯全体员工愿与各界有识之士共同发展,共创美好未来。